Which to choose 26" Vee
So I 've been looking, and think I have narrowed down my choices. First off, I've notice a lot of 17" boats, but the seem to tend to want to duck dive a lot. But the 23- 26" class seems to not be so bad. I am debating between four boats. Any feedback for below, or other options your would recommend for $250 or less.
$150 Helion Rivos - 550sized Brushed, 2600 NiMH battery included, 30A receiver (not Lipo Ready) ($90 brushless motor and esc upgrade package available) Pro Boat Stealthwave - 550 sized Brushed, 2400 NiMh battery included, 60a Lipo ready receiver $215-250 range Helion Rivos BL - 1800kv Brushless, 3S 3600 25C LiPo included, 40A receiver ($250) Pro Boat Shockwave - 2000kv Brushless, no battery incl, 30A receiver ($215) |
26" Deep Vee is nice but once you get in the water and out there it get's pretty small. I've had a few and bigger is better if you step up a bit. The most bang for your buck in Deep Vee is the Hobbyking Inception. 36" hull and 40" overall it stands out and still is good size in the water.
